What is CVE-2026-0063?

A logic error in the PhoneInterfaceManager's setAllowedCarriers function creates a vulnerability that allows local privilege escalation. This security gap enables unauthorized users to circumvent carrier restrictions without requiring additional execution permissions or user interaction. Addressing this flaw is essential for maintaining the integrity and security of the Android operating system.
